Ace Double (M-113) 1965 paperback: The Rithian Terror, bound with a collection Off Center - both sides by Damon Knight. This is the first book appearance for each.

The Rithian Terror - Cover and frontispiece by Jack Gaughan; 111 pages. Magazine version was titled "Double Meaning" in Startling Stories, January 1953.
The fate of the Earth Empire held in the balance - and Security Commissioner Spangler knew it was up to him to find the monster - the Rithian Terror, as some called it. Seven Rithians had landed on Earth, and six had been disposed of. Only one was loose. He explained to Pembum, a Colonial sent to help find the monster, that testing with the stereoscopic fluoroscope would surely flush it out. But Pembum pointed out that while the Rithi have no bones, nothing could prevent one from swallowing a skeleton...


(Bound with) Off Center - Cover and 5 small illustrations by Jack Gaughan; 141 pages.

What Rough Beast
The Second-Class Citizen
Be My Guest
God's Nose
Catch That Martian

These originally appeared in Magazine of F&SF, Fantastic Universe, Rogue, and Galaxy, from 1952 to 1964. Damon Knight is at his best at shorter lengths like these, and most of these are not available in any other Knight collection.
